About this Artwork
We believe the sky can’t be yellow, but I think it can. Its image in the water may be deeper. The Sea is the synonym of the Infinity, Eternity, Time. The Sea contains an avalanchine dynamic power, permanent move and changing. Nobody knows where the wind will blow and how strong.
Sail is a symbol of determination to unknown, to knowledge, a symbol of will and new search. Two dominating colors, yellow and purple are not pure, because they have many admixtures. Yellow represents non material gladness. This color is some kind of hope for greater happiness in all its forms from sex to some philosophical or religious views. The yellow sea is like a life where we are always looking for problem solution and finally find them. This color has an incited energy. The purple sail is like a symbol of magic state of mind. Purple shows a mystical alliance what gives a life to dreams and wishes.
